aboutsummaryrefslogtreecommitdiffstats
path: root/core/vm/sqlvm/cmd
diff options
context:
space:
mode:
Diffstat (limited to 'core/vm/sqlvm/cmd')
-rw-r--r--core/vm/sqlvm/cmd/gen-op-test/main.go21
1 files changed, 21 insertions, 0 deletions
diff --git a/core/vm/sqlvm/cmd/gen-op-test/main.go b/core/vm/sqlvm/cmd/gen-op-test/main.go
new file mode 100644
index 000000000..60387dddf
--- /dev/null
+++ b/core/vm/sqlvm/cmd/gen-op-test/main.go
@@ -0,0 +1,21 @@
+package main
+
+import (
+ "flag"
+
+ "github.com/dexon-foundation/dexon/core/vm/sqlvm/runtime"
+)
+
+func main() {
+ var output string
+ flag.StringVar(
+ &output, "o", "./runtime/instructions_op_test.go",
+ "the output path of generated testcases",
+ )
+ flag.Parse()
+
+ err := runtime.RenderOpTest(output)
+ if err != nil {
+ panic(err)
+ }
+}